Sembcorp Inaugurates 588MW Solar Plant in Oman

Sembcorp Industries inaugurated its 588MW Manah 2 Solar Independent Power Project in the Sultanate of Oman, the company said. The plant, the company’s largest utility-scale solar farm globally, was inaugurated Bilarab bin Haitham al Said, the second son of Sultan Haitham bin Tariq. The project, completed four months ahead of schedule, is Sembcorp’s first greenfield renewables development in the Middle East. The plant will supply clean energy to approximately 60,000 households and reduce carbon emissions. Vipul Tuli, CEO, Middle East and Chairman, South Asia, Sembcorp Industries, said, “The inauguration of Manah 2 Solar Power Plant marks a key milestone in Sembcorp’s commitment to Oman’s transition to a sustainable future and strengthening partnership with Nama Power and Water Procurement Company. As Sembcorp’s largest utility-scale solar plant globally, it supports Oman Vision 2040 by advancing the nation’s renewable energy targets.”

Flender launches India’s largest wind gearbox test rig in Walajabad

Flender has inaugurated a 13.5 MW wind turbine gearbox test rig at its Walajabad facility near Chennai, marking the largest installation of its kind in India.
